Section 1: The Classic French Tip with a Twist

Modernizing the White Tip

The key to a standout French tip lies in the white tip itself. Experiment with different shapes and styles to create a unique look. Keep the traditional straight line or opt for a V-shaped tip, an angular design, or even an ombré effect.

Embracing Color

Don’t limit yourself to white tips! In 2015, nail designs 2015 french tip embraced color. Try painting the tips in your favorite shade of blue, green, or even glitter. For a more subtle approach, try a pale pink or lavender tip.

Section 2: Embellishments and Accessories

Jewels and Studs

Elevate your French tips with a touch of sparkle! Adorn your nails with small jewels, rhinestones, or studs. Place them along the cuticle line, the tip, or create a unique design.

Nail Art Stickers

Nail art stickers are an easy way to add instant flair to your French manicure. From delicate lace to bold geometric patterns, there’s an endless variety to choose from. Simply peel and stick!

Section 3: Advanced Techniques

Ombre French Tip

Master the art of the ombre French tip for a sophisticated look. Create a seamless blend from a light base color to a darker shade at the tip. Use a sponge or airbrush for a professional finish.

Reverse French Tip

Put a quirky spin on the classic by creating a reverse French tip. Paint the half-moon shape at the base of your nail in a contrasting color, leaving the rest of the nail nude or in a light shade.

What is special about the French tip design?

  • The classic French tip is a subtle and elegant design that involves a white tip on a nude or pale pink base.
  • It can be customized with different colors or patterns for a modern take.

How do I create a French tip nail design?

  • Use clear nail polish as a base.
  • Apply a strip of white nail polish near the edge of your nail.
  • Let it dry and then apply a top coat.

What are the different variations of the French tip design?

  • Double French Tip: Creating two tips with different colors or widths.
  • Reverse French Tip: Creating the tip at the base of the nail instead of the edge.
  • V-Tip: Creating an angled tip that resembles the letter "V."

How do I make my French tip nails last longer?

  • Use a high-quality base coat and top coat.
  • Let each coat dry thoroughly before applying the next.
  • Avoid using harsh chemicals or picking at your nails.

What are the advantages of a French tip design?

  • Versatility: Suitable for all occasions and outfits.
  • Sophistication: Gives a polished and refined look.
  • Easy to maintain: Regrowth is less noticeable compared to solid colors.

What are the disadvantages of a French tip design?

  • Can be time-consuming to create: Especially with intricate or double French tips.
  • May require touch-ups: As the nail grows, the tip may become less visible.
  • Not as trendy as some other designs: May be considered outdated by some.
